Historic Chicken a la King
2 sticks butter
1-1/2 cups flour
8 cups (about) chicken stock (canned is okay)
1 cup half-and-half
1 pound cooked, skinned chicken meat, diced
1 large red bell pepper, cut into 1/4-inch strips
1 large green bell pepper, cut into 1/4-inch strips
1/2 pound sliced mushrooms, sauteed in butter
salt and white pepper to taste
baked puff pastry shells
extra pastry dough
chicken-shaped cookie cutter

Melt butter in large saucepan. Whisk in flour, cooking over moderate heat a few minutes. Gradually add chicken stock, whisking. Cook over moderate heat, whisking, until thickened. Whisk in half-and-half. Cook over low heat about 25 minutes. Add more chicken stock, depending on desired consistency. Add remaining ingredients--except for cookie cutter and extra dough. Cook over low heat about twenty minutes. Serve in pastry shells, with the chicken cut-out on top. Serves eight.
